Part 1: Traditional Rose Blooms
Sub-section 1: Hand-Painted Roses
For these with a gradual hand and a eager eye for element, hand-painted roses are an beautiful choice. Utilizing a fine-tipped brush and your favourite nail polish shades, you may create life like and lifelike rosebuds in your nails. Begin by outlining the fundamental form of the flower, then fill within the petals and add delicate shading and highlights.
Sub-section 2: Stamped Roses
When you’re in search of a faster and simpler strategy to obtain rose-adorned nails, stamping is a wonderful alternative. You may want a stamping plate with rose designs and a stamping software. Merely apply nail polish to the specified design on the plate, scrape off the surplus, and switch the picture onto your nails utilizing the stamping software.
Part 2: Fashionable Rose Designs
Sub-section 1: Geometric Roses
For a up to date twist on traditional roses, strive creating geometric variations. Utilizing masking tape or nail vinyls, you may part off areas of your nails to create sharp traces and angles. Then, paint in several shades of polish to create the phantasm of rose petals folding and overlapping.
Sub-section 2: Adverse House Roses
Adverse area designs are a good way to showcase your nails’ pure magnificence whereas nonetheless incorporating a contact of rose magnificence. Paint a stable base coloration in your nails, then use a dotting software or toothpick to create tiny dots or dashes that resemble rose buds or petals. Go away some areas of the nail uncovered to create a unfavourable area impact.
Part 3: Rose Accents
Sub-section 1: Rose Petals
Rose petals can be utilized so as to add a fragile contact to your manicures. Apply a transparent base coat and prepare small, dried rose petals in your nails. Seal them in with one other layer of clear polish for a refined but charming impact.
Sub-section 2: Rose Gildings
For a extra glamorous look, think about using rose-shaped elaborations equivalent to studs, jewels, or rhinestones. Prepare them in your nails in a floral sample to create a wide ranging and crowd pleasing design.

7. How do you paint a water marble rose in your nails?
To color a water marble rose in your nails, you’ll need a base coat, nail polish in numerous shades of pink and pink, a bowl of water, and a toothpick. First, apply a base coat to your nails. Then, drop just a few drops of nail polish into the bowl of water. Use a toothpick to swirl the nail polish round within the water. Dip your nails into the water and pull them out. The nail polish will switch to your nails in a marbled design. Lastly, apply a high coat to seal within the design.
